We are a creative studio specializing in innovative visual experiences. We work with top-tier clients to transform spaces using cutting-edge projection mapping technology. We're looking for a talented Projection Mapping Designer to join our dynamic team and help bring our visual concepts to life. Key Responsibilities: - Create and execute projection mapping designs for buildings, events, and installations. - Collaborate with the creative team to develop visual concepts and storyboards. - Use specialized software (e.g., MadMapper, Resolume, TouchDesigner) to design and implement projection mappings. - Work closely with technical teams to align projections with physical structures, ensuring seamless integration and alignment. - Participate in on-site setups, adjustments, and live events to ensure high-quality execution. - Stay up to date with the latest trends and technologies in projection mapping and visual design. Requirements: - Proven experience in projection mapping, visual design, or related fields. - Proficiency in projection mapping software (e.g., MadMapper, Resolume, TouchDesigner). - Strong understanding of 3D modeling, animation, and visual effects. - Creative mindset with a keen eye for detail and aesthetics. - 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ment. - Excellent problem-solving skills and adaptability to work on-site during live events. - A portfolio showcasing relevant work is required. The roles and responsibilities of the Entry-Level Bindery Operator position include sorting, drilling, padding, and folding materials to produce finished print products. Because most of the work is done by machine, the Entry-Level Bindery Operator will work with scoring/creasing, stitching, drilling, and binding machines. Attention to detail is a requirement for this position! Also, time management skills and the ability to prioritize are “musts,” as many projects may be scheduled simultaneously and be in the production stage at the same time. If a problem arises, the Entry-Level Bindery Operator must be able to communicate the issue to the print production leaders. REQUIREMENTS - Bindery experience: 1-3 years - English communication skills: Ability to follow written and verbal instructions - Detail-focused - Ability to multi-task and work in a fast-paced, evolving environment - Authorization to work legally in the United States - Valid US driver’s license (preferably NJ or NYC) QUALIFICATIONS General knowledge of folding, stitching, and coil binding machines. Ability to read and interpret written and verbal work orders or other job specifications containing bindery requirements that indicate the number and sequence of machine operations required to complete the work and to maintain dimensional accuracy in accordance with provided instructions.
